The telethon proposes in a recurring way some short sequences in duplex staging the demonstrations of what the organizers call “the force T” which, on the whole territory, organizes local mobilizations. One of the central elements of these mobilizations is that they are accompanied by an intense sharing of emotions, in the forefront of which appears enthusiasm. By formalizing this passion through philosophies, in particular the 17th century English one, it is possible to see a number of phenomena on which the traditional analysis of the mobilizations remains blind. One is thus led to carry the glance on the sociability which is woven in the course of the mobilization, not so much like a pre-condition, but as the very bottom on which a collective emotion is displayed. One understands also that this coordination getting through the sharing of an emotion remains very largely external with the cause which is the reason of the mobilization. The value which is concerned here is not initially that of “solidarity” (with the patients), but that of the association of all (sick people, people in good health, researchers, “quidams,” journalists, organizers, etc.), or, to say it better: that of the very sociability.
